Comprehending the Auction Process
Before joining a public auction, whether in-person or via online art auctions, it's critical to comprehend how the procedure functions. Auctions operate on a competitive bidding system, where buyers put quotes on items, and the highest possible prospective buyer wins. While the idea is easy, the approach behind successful bidding process requires preparation, perseverance, and understanding.
Many auctions provide magazines or on the internet listings prior to the event. These resources use in-depth descriptions of the items offered, including provenance, problem, and approximated worth. Assessing this information enables prospective buyers to recognize pieces of passion and set realistic assumptions.

Setting a Budget and Sticking to It
The exhilaration of an online public auction can in some cases result in impulsive decisions. First-time buyers frequently obtain caught up in bidding battles, which can drive prices past their original spending plan. Setting a clear budget plan before the auction and sticking to it is important to avoiding overspending.
To establish a spending plan, consider additional expenses beyond the winning quote. These might include the purchaser's costs, tax obligations, shipping charges, and potential reconstruction expenses. By determining the complete cost in advance, you can bid with self-confidence, understanding that your purchase stays within your financial limitations.
Establishing a Bidding Strategy
An effective auction experience is not nearly bidding the highest possible quantity. Strategic bidding can enhance your possibilities of winning without paying too much. One efficient strategy is to begin with a moderate bid to indicate passion without revealing way too much passion. Observing various other bidders' behavior can supply useful understanding right into the competition.
Timing is likewise a crucial factor. Some seasoned prospective buyers wait till the last minutes to put a quote, intending to prevent additional competitors. Others like to make incremental increases to gradually examine the limits of their competitors. Comprehending different bidding methods can aid first-time buyers navigate the fast-paced environment with self-confidence.
Comprehending the Different Types of Auctions
Auctions come in numerous styles, each with its own regulations and dynamics. Traditional in-person auctions provide an interesting environment where bidders can connect with the auctioneer and view products firsthand. Online art auctions, on the other hand, offer ease and availability, allowing customers to take part from anywhere.
Timed public auctions are one more preferred style where bidding process occurs within a collection period. The greatest bid at the closing time wins the product. Unlike real-time auctions, there is no instant back-and-forth bidding process, making it vital to put a solid quote prior to time runs out.
Preventing Common Pitfalls
First-time auction buyers may come across challenges in the process, yet knowing possible mistakes can assist protect against expensive blunders. One common mistake is falling short to read the auction terms. These plans lay out important details such as payment due dates, return plans, and responsibility for problems.
An additional pitfall is overbidding due to enjoyment or competition. While winning a quote is thrilling, it's important to remain focused on the item's actual value rather than getting caught up in the minute. If a bidding process battle presses the rate past your budget plan, it's finest to step back and wait for another opportunity.
